In 2020, a historic drought struck California’s Central Valley, where one-quarter of the food produced in the United States is grown, causing farmers to pump vast amounts of water from wells to keep their crops alive. All that pumping reduced the water pressure within the porous sediments storing that water deep underground. As a result, those sediments compacted over the next 2 years—causing land surfaces in the northern part of the Central Valley, known as the Sacramento Valley, to sink by more than half a meter.
This kind of subsidence is typically reversible, or “elastic.” Rainfall seeps into the ground and refills the empty sediment pores, causing the surface to rebound. But in 2021, the aquifer compacted so quickly and extensively that it likely permanently lost its capacity to store water, researchers report today in the Proceedings of the National Academy of Sciences.
